Популярная серия "Шаг за шагом" предназначена для тех, кто осваивает новые программные продукты на курсах или самостоятельно. Изучив данную книгу, вы пройдете основной курс программирования на Microsoft Visual Basic 6.0. Секрет, как стать профессиональнымразработчиком программ на Visuall Basic, состоит в том, чтобы писать программы, требующие от вас применения самых разнообразных возможностей Visual Basic. Среди них: доскональное знание и способность на практике применять стандартные средства управленияпанели инструментов и компоненты ActiveX; умение правильно устанавливать и манипулировать свойствами, функциями и событиями объекта; способность писать ясный и четкий программный код с возможностью повторного использования некоторых сегментов программы вдальнейшем; умение создавать наглядный и эффективный интерфейс пользователя. В каждом из уроков данного курса внимание читателя акцентируется именно на этих принципах программирования. Вы обнаруживаете, что сможете немедленно применить полученные вами навыки и знания, изучив содержащиеся в этой книге примеры, при создании более сложных приложений на Visual Basic для выполнения реальных практических задач. К книге прилагается компакт - диск со всеми примерами из уроков этой книги.
Основная задача книги - быстро ознакомить разработчиков Visual Basic с изменениями в .NET Framework. Программисты, использующие Java, C++, Delphi или другие инструменты разработки приложений и интересующиеся Visual Basic или технологией .NET Framework, также найдут эту книгу полезной. Хотя книга посвящена Visual Basic.NET, ее основная цель - продемонстрировать взаимодействие Visual Basic и .NET Framework. Книга знакомит с новой парадигмой разработки программного обеспечения, представленной .NET Framework, включая ASP.NET, Windows Forms и Web-службы. Книга предназначена для опытных программистов-практиков.
Visual Basic .NET - результат самых решительных изменений, когда-либо сделанных в популярном языке Visual Basic. Эта книга, написанная командой экспертов Visual Basic .NET, поможет вам овладеть всеми нюансами платформы .NET, будь вы ветеран Visual Basic 6 или разработчик на ASP, или даже просто новичок в программировании. Начав с обзора новых объектно-ориентированных свойств, авторы познакомят вас с основами языка Visual Basic, со средой разработки Visual Studio .NET, технологиями ADO.NET и XML и объяснят на примерах, как создавать формы Windows, приложения ASP.NET и Web-сервисы.
В этих официальных учебных пособиях Microsoft по курсу MCAD/MCSD, предназначенных для профессиональных разработчиков, рассказывается, как создавать Web- и Windows-приложения с использованием Microsoft .NET Framework, а также как подготовиться к сертификационным экзаменам №№ 70-306, 70-305 и 70-315, входящим в число основных экзаменов по программам MCAD/MCSD. Здесь подробно и глубоко рассказано о разработке современных сложных Web- и Windows-приложений с помощью .NET Framework, изложены новые концепции иметоды использования новых версий Microsoft Visual Basic и Microsoft Visual C на соответствующей платформе .NET. Кроме того, эти учебные курсы служат для самостоятельной подготовки к сдаче экзаменов 70-306, 70-305 и 70-315 и содержат полный набор учебныхматериалов: занятий для самоподготовки, упражнений и тестов.
Доступно и подробно описан Visual Basic 2005. Рассмотрены стандартные элементы для разработки пользовательского интерфейса, а также применение в проектах таймеров, ползунков, гиперссылок и других элементов интерфейса. Уделено внимание основным понятиям объектно-ориентированного программирования и классам. Изложены вопросы работы с графикой с использованием интерфейса GDI+, создания справочной системы в формате HTML и собственного установочного компакт-диска. Большое внимание уделяется созданию информационных систем, предназначенных для управления базами данных: проектированию форм для ввода и редактирования данных с использованием компонентов ADO.NET, подготовке отчетов с помощью генератора отчетов Crystal Reports. Приведена методика разработки интернет-приложений. Описаны средства отладки приложений и обработки ошибок. Для начинающих программистов.
Кетков А., Кетков Ю. Практика программирования: Бейсик, Си, Паскаль (+дискета) – СПб.: БХВ-Петербург, – 2001 480 с. (Серия: Самоучитель) 5-94157-104-6 Содержится более 130 готовых к исполнению программ, большинство из которых представлено на трех алгоритмических языках - Бейсике, Си и Паскале. Все разделы предваряются описанием соответствующих конструкций каждого алгоритмического языка. При этом особое внимание обращается на общность языковых средств рассматриваемых систем программирования - QBasic, Turbo С (Borland C++) и Turbo Pascal. Текстам программ предшествуют советы по их разработке с учетом специфики того или иного алгоритмического языка и описание наиболее характерных особенностей. Для учащихся старших классов и студентов вузов.
Данный справочник содержит всю необходимую информацию о синтаксисе, операторах, типах данных, обработке ошибок, концепции объектно-ориентированного программирования и объектных моделях. Рассмотрены новые функции Visual Basic .NET, использование XML и ADO .NET, объектные модели для пакета Microsoft Office XP. Приводятся примеры решений типичных задач и советы профессиональных программистов.
Роббинс Дж. Отладка приложений (+ CD-ROM) – БХВ-Петербург, – 2001 512 с. (Серия: Мастер. Практическое руководство) ISBN 0-7356-0886-5, 5-94157-056-2. Рассматриваются методики отладки (отладочные операторы, трассировка, блочное тестирование), основы работы и типы отладчиков, точки прерывания и пошаговый проход таблицы символов и форматы символов отладки, удаленная отладка, автоматизированное тестирование. Большое внимание уделено дизассемблированию программ и работе с отладчиками Visual C++ и Visual Basic, мультимашинной и мультипроцессной трассировке многопоточным блокировкам. В приложениях содержатся сведения о журналах программы Dr. Watson, ресурсах Интернета для Windows-разработчиков и форматах точек прерывания.
Книга посвящена вопросам создания службы Windows с помощью Visual Basic .NET. В VB6 службы Windows было сложно создавать (и почти невозможно отлаживать). .NET изменила эту ситуацию, службы Windows можно легко создавать на всех языках .NET, просто расширяя базовые классы служб Windows, предоставляемые .NET Framework. Помимо базовых принципов, авторы рассматривают классы, от которых будет производиться наследование при создании служб Windows, разбирают, как приложения служб Windows следует структурировать, и описывают использование шаблонов проектирования, которые показывают, как службы Windows могут быть эффективно использованы в качестве частей больших систем.
По Excel есть немало серьезных книг, но эта все равно единственная, где разработка приложений рассматривается в широком плане. Дело в том, что VBA - всего лишь один из компонентов разработки приложений (правда, компонент этот достаточно большой). А такой программный продукт, как Excel, отличается крайней таинственностью. В нем множество интересных возможностей, притаившихся где-то в глубинах и неведомых простому пользователю. Кроме того, некоторые хорошо известные возможности можно использовать по-новому. Миллионы людей по всему миру используют Excel. И только несколько процентов пользователей действительно понимают, на что способен этот продукт. В данной книге автор попытается ввести вас в эту элитную компанию. Вы готовы?